Having to run (and re-run) a server while running verifications can be annoying while you are iterating on code. This makes it so you can use the library client -- and because it is OpenAI client compatible, it all works. ## Test Plan ``` pytest -s -v tests/verifications/openai_api/test_responses.py \ --provider=stack:together \ --model meta-llama/Llama-4-Scout-17B-16E-Instruct ```
